The Greyador German Pinscher Mix: An Overview

The Greyador German Pinscher mix is a crossbreed between the Greyador and the German Pinscher. The Greyador, also known as the Lab Greyhound mix, is a blend of the Greyhound and the Labrador Retriever. Known for their speed, agility, and friendly nature, Greyadors are popular family pets and are often used as working dogs in various capacities. On the other hand, the German Pinscher is a medium-sized breed known for their intelligence, loyalty, and agility. They are often used as guard dogs and are known for their protective nature.

Training and Exercise

Due to their high intelligence and energetic nature, the Greyador German Pinscher mix requires plenty of mental and physical stimulation. They thrive on challenges and enjoy learning new tricks and commands. Training them is a breeze, as they are quick learners and eager to please.

When it comes to exercise, the Greyador German Pinscher mix requires at least 1-2 hours of vigorous activity per day. This can include walks, runs, and playtime in the yard. They also enjoy participating in canine sports such as agility and obedience trials. Without enough exercise, they may become bored and destructive, so it is important to provide them with plenty of opportunities to burn off their energy.

Health Considerations

Like all crossbreeds, the Greyador German Pinscher mix may inherit certain health conditions from their parent breeds. It is important to be aware of these potential health issues and take steps to prevent them from occurring. Some common health problems that may affect the Greyador German Pinscher mix include hip dysplasia, progressive retinal atrophy, and bloat.

To ensure that your Greyador German Pinscher mix stays healthy and happy, it is important to provide them with regular exercise, a balanced diet, and regular veterinary check-ups. By taking good care of your dog, you can help them live a long and fulfilling life.
